计算机组成原理复习题详解:总线、中断与指令处理、机器字长、系统总线及优先级控制。
版权申诉
179 浏览量
更新于2024-04-04
收藏 2.37MB DOCX 举报
计算机组成原理是计算机科学中的一个基础概念,它主要研究计算机系统的硬件和软件组成以及它们之间的相互作用。在复习计算机组成原理时,我们需要掌握一些重要名词的概念和定义,例如总线、系统总线、总线判优、机器字长、周期挪用、向量地址、多重中断、硬件向量法、中断隐指令等。总线是连接多个部件的信息传输线,是各部件共享的传输介质;系统总线指CPU、主存、I/O各大部件之间的信息传输线,按系统总线传输信息的不同,分为数据总线、地址总线、控制总线;总线判优主要解决多个主设备在申请占用总线时的优先级问题;机器字长是指CPU一次能处理数据的位数;周期挪用指在一个时钟周期内执行两条指令的情况;向量地址是操作系统中用来存储中断服务程序入口地址的地址编号;多重中断是CPU在处理中断过程中又出现新的中断请求的情况;硬件向量法是利用硬件产生向量地址,再由向量地址找到中断服务程序的入口地址;中断隐指令是在机器指令系统中没有的指令,是CPU在中断周期内由硬件自动完成的一条指令。
在学习计算机组成原理时,我们也需要了解一些概念和原理,例如冯·诺伊曼体系结构、存储器层次结构、指令执行过程、中断处理过程等。冯·诺伊曼体系结构是现代计算机的基本结构,包括存储器、运算器、控制器和输入输出设备;存储器层次结构是指计算机内存的多层次分类,包括高速缓存、主存和辅助存储器;指令执行过程是CPU执行一条指令的全过程,包括指令获取、解码、执行和结果写回;中断处理过程是当外部设备请求CPU服务时,CPU会暂停当前任务,处理中断请求。
另外,在计算机组成原理中,还涉及到一些重要概念和技术,例如指令系统和地址码、I/O系统、总线结构、中断系统、DMA传输等。指令系统和地址码是CPU执行指令时的编解码方式和地址寻址模式;I/O系统是计算机与外部设备之间进行数据传输和通信的系统;总线结构是计算机内各组件之间传输数据和控制信息的通道;中断系统是处理来自外部设备的中断请求并切换到中断服务程序的系统;DMA传输是直接内存存取技术,用于无需CPU干预地进行数据传输。
在计算机组成原理的学习中,我们还需要了解一些底层原理和技术,例如时钟和定时、中断处理机制、缓存技术、存储系统设计等。时钟和定时是计算机系统中用来控制各个部件协调工作的设备;中断处理机制是如何处理来自硬件和软件的中断请求;缓存技术是用来提高计算机性能的一种技术,包括高速缓存和虚拟内存;存储系统设计是设计计算机主存、辅存和高速缓存的存储结构和算法。
综上所述,计算机组成原理是计算机科学的重要基础概念,涉及到计算机系统的硬件和软件组成、底层原理和技术、系统结构和设计等方面。通过深入学习和理解计算机组成原理,我们可以更好地理解计算机系统的工作原理,提高计算机系统设计和优化的能力,为日后的计算机科学研究和应用打下扎实的基础。希望以上内容能够帮助大家更好地复习和理解计算机组成原理的相关知识。
2022-01-17 上传
2022-07-09 上传
2022-11-29 上传
2022-03-15 上传
2021-09-19 上传
103 浏览量
hualuodiewu
- 粉丝: 0
- 资源: 5万+
最新资源
- pip-chill:更轻松的“点冻结”
- 实存帐存对比表DOC
- jquery.page分页控件.zip
- sql-q:JDBC 模板
- 数据结构
- ange-button
- stable-baselines:稳定基线的镜子
- 电子功用-太阳能电池板激光刻划系统及刻划方法
- 材料调拨管理方法DOC
- ut-ussd
- NewRepo:创建一个空白仓库
- galgebra:SymPy的符号几何AlgebraCalculus软件包
- 在 C# 中使用 MATLAB 结构体和 Builder NE:“MATLAB 艺术”帖子的代码 - 展示了如何在 MATLAB 和 C# 之间传递结构体。-matlab开发
- mysql-8.0.18-winx64.zip
- js特效脚本含源码和说明迅雷网七屏flash广告轮换
- 电子功用-带有市电互补功能的太阳能模块化嵌入式控制器